Possible silent hypoxia associated factors involved in COVID-19. Silent Hypoxia has been associated with several COVID-19 related symptoms. The condition can result in overexpression of ACE-2 receptors thereby increasing the risk of damage through COVID-19 infection. Besides, the condition can further contribute to the mechanism of “cytokine storm” by recruiting different mediators of inflammation. Moreover, silent hypoxia can cause serious endothelial damage through NF-kB transcription factor activation. Silent hypoxia can also signal a different immune-metabolism pathway and cause secondary organ damage. All these factors lead to the critical condition of patients along with an increased mortality rate among COVID-19 patients
